Lets compare vitamin content per 300 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ots vs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ked:
300 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 2.9 times more Vitamin B1, 13.7 times more Vitamin B2, 4.4 times more Vitamin B3, 8.1 times more Vitamin B5, 57.4 times more Vitamin B6, 4.7 times more Vitamin B9, 276.2 times more Vitamin E and 465 times more Vitamin K than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ked.
300 calories of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6, Vitamin B9,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
Both Boiled and Drained Frozen Carrots as well as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 in 300 calories.
Comparing minerals per 300 calories for Cooked Frozen Carrots vs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ked:
300 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 39.9 times more Calcium, 22 times more Copper, 6.3 times more Iron, 16.7 times more Magnesium, 10.9 times more Manganese, 8.2 times more Phosphorus, 31.6 times more Potassium, 1.8 times more Selenium, 1.7 times more Sodium, 21.8 times more Zinc and 155.2 times more Water than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ked.
300 calories of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Copper, Magnesium, Manganese, Phosphorus, Potassium,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 300 calories:
300 calories of Cooked Frozen Carrots have 4.1 times more Omega 3, 1.8 times more Carbohydrate, 32.2 times more Fiber and 2.3 times more Protein than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ked.
While 300 kcal of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ked contain 3.1 times more Fat and 6.8 times more Saturated Fat than Boiled and Drained Frozen Carrots.
Both Cooked Frozen Carrots and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ked offer comparable quantities of Energy and Omega 6 per 300 calories.
300 calories of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, baked prov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3, Fiber and Protein
